王 翔,丁 偉
(獨(dú)山子石化公司煉油廠儀表車間,新疆克拉瑪依 833600)
Modbus通信協(xié)議在CS3000中的應(yīng)用
王 翔,丁 偉
(獨(dú)山子石化公司煉油廠儀表車間,新疆克拉瑪依 833600)
介紹了Modbus協(xié)議的含義及其數(shù)據(jù)傳輸方式,闡述了該廠CS3000系統(tǒng)與其他各子系統(tǒng)之間的應(yīng)用,分析了基于Modbus進(jìn)行數(shù)據(jù)交換的硬件結(jié)構(gòu)配置及軟件組態(tài)的應(yīng)用。同時說明了利用Modbus通信協(xié)議來解決CS3000系統(tǒng)與第三方智能控制儀表之間的通信,在煉油自動控制系統(tǒng)的實(shí)際操作中極大地方便了現(xiàn)場的控制和操作,是一個值得推廣的方式。
Modbus通信協(xié)議;傳輸方式;數(shù)據(jù)轉(zhuǎn)換;主—從設(shè)備;硬件配置;軟件配置
某新建成的千萬噸煉油項(xiàng)目中,根據(jù)各個裝置的工況及生產(chǎn)要求不同,DCS采用CS3000系統(tǒng);緊急停車系統(tǒng)(ESD)采用TRICONEX控制系統(tǒng);電氣控制系統(tǒng)(ECS)采用RCS-9700后臺監(jiān)控系統(tǒng),而其他的一些小系統(tǒng)如PAS原油過濾系統(tǒng)、水利出焦系統(tǒng)等多采用PLC控制系統(tǒng)。為了實(shí)現(xiàn)對不同系統(tǒng)控制設(shè)備的集中監(jiān)控,設(shè)置CS3000為主要監(jiān)控系統(tǒng),其他系統(tǒng)通過Modbus通信協(xié)議將數(shù)據(jù)傳送到CS3000系統(tǒng)中顯示的方法來實(shí)現(xiàn)生產(chǎn)工藝對不同系統(tǒng)控制設(shè)備的集中監(jiān)控。
如圖1所示,Modbus通信協(xié)議基本上遵循主—從設(shè)備(Master and Slave)。根據(jù)Modbus通信協(xié)議的規(guī)定,必須一方為主設(shè)備,另一方為從設(shè)備,不能互換角色。在該項(xiàng)目中以CS3000監(jiān)控系統(tǒng)為主設(shè)備,PLC,ECD,ECS等為從設(shè)備,CS3000系統(tǒng)一直檢查從設(shè)備的各種信息,然后顯示并對各種邏輯計(jì)算及控制進(jìn)行處理。

圖1 主—從設(shè)備查詢回應(yīng)表
在CS3000系統(tǒng)中用來與子系統(tǒng)建立串口通信的專用卡件是ALR121卡?!?br>